Drug and alcohol treatment services are offered in a vast range of formats, so there is truly something for everyone in Homelake. Treatment services can be done in both an inpatient and outpatient basis, where outpatient services range from 1 or 2 days of treatment per week to intensive outpatient treatment which is delivered daily. Outpatient treatment services range from individual counseling and group counseling, to more advanced psychotherapies to modify behavior and motivate clients to stay sober.
Residential and inpatient rehabilitation is there for those who suffer with more substantial histories of drug and alcohol abuse, spanning from 30 day programs to 90 day programs. Some treatment programs offer what is called a Therapeutic Community model, where clients may stay as long as a year in certain situations. The longer the person stays in in treatment and benefits from rehabilitation services and a sober atmosphere, the greater their chances of remaining sober and being able stay that way without needing that robust system of recovery and support. Services at an inpatient or residential drug and alcohol treatment program are commonly more diverse and can encompass treatment for addiction but also other co-occurring mental health disorders. Aftercare and relapse prevention services are essential even after long-term rehabilitation, and many centers recommend continued participation in the program for a few months until the person has transitioned into a clean and sober way of life.
